I use the Kenai chest holster to ride my mountain bike. It carries a J Frame so is somewhat lighter than you want to carry.
My experience is that I can ride my bike on very rough terrain and absolutely forget I am wearing it. It does not rub, bounce or shift on me. Most people who write reviews are carrying larger than a J-frame but are not bouncing and vibrating as much as mountain bike riding does.

I bought this brand because of the reviews I read over many different forums. They were VERY few negative reports. I found a few complaints about the cost or a few people complaining about it not being leather.

EDIT: I wear a 3X size basketball type or weight lifter type jersey over my Kenai. It covers the gun and all the straps except for the one under my left arm pit. I am seldom seen by anyone, but if I am all they see is a bike rider with a baggy shirt. The large arm holes allow a very easy and fast draw.
 
The El Paso Saddlery "1942 Tanker" holster is at once elegant and practical. It is their copy of the WWII-era M7. The lift-the-dot closure is extremely secure. It is also quite durable: I carried my service pistol in one in Afghanistan, over my body armor, and no worries.
